| 1 | Therapeutic potential of brain-derived neurotrophic factor(BDNF)and a small molecular mimics of BDNF for traumatic brain injury显示文摘Traumatic brain injury(TBI) is a major health problem worldwide.Following primary mechanical insults,a cascade of secondary injuries often leads to further neural tissue loss.Thus far there is no cure to rescue the damaged neural tissue.Current therapeutic strategies primarily target the secondary injuries focusing on neuroprotection and neuroregeneration.The neurotrophin brain-derived neurotrophic factor(BDNF) has significant effect in both aspects,promoting neuronal survival,synaptic plasticity and neurogenesis.Recently,the flavonoid 7,8-dihydroxyflavone(7,8-DHF),a small Trk B agonist that mimics BDNF function,has shown similar effects as BDNF in promoting neuronal survival and regeneration following TBI.Compared to BDNF,7,8-DHF has a longer half-life and much smaller molecular size,capable of penetrating the blood-brain barrier,which makes it possible for non-invasive clinical application.In this review,we summarize functions of the BDNF/Trk B signaling pathway and studies examining the potential of BDNF and 7,8-DHF as a therapy for TBI. | Mary Wurzelmann Jennifer Romeika Dong Sun | 2017 | Neural Regeneration Research2017,12,1: | 21 |

| 10 | Enduring association between irritable bowel syndrome and war trauma during the Nicaragua civil war period:A population-based study显示文摘BACKGROUND Psychosocial and physical trauma are known risk factors for irritable bowel syndrome(IBS),including in war veterans,whereas war exposure in civilians is unclear.Nicaragua experienced two wars,1970-1990:The Sandinistas Revolution(1970s)and The Contra War(1980s).Our aim was to investigate the role of exposure to war trauma in the subsequent development of IBS in the context of an established health surveillance system(11000 households).AIM To investigate in a civilian population the relationship between exposure to war trauma and events and the subsequent development of IBS in the context of an established public health and demographic surveillance system in western Nicaragua.METHODS We conducted a nested population-based,cross-sectional study focused on functional gastrointestinal disorders based on Rome II criteria.1617 adults were randomly selected.The Spanish Rome II Modular Questionnaire and Harvard Trauma Questionnaire were validated in Nicaragua.War exposure was assessed with 10 measures of direct and indirect war trauma and post-war effects.Multiple exposures were defined by≥3 measures.RESULTS The prevalence of IBS was 15.2%[Female(F)17.1%,Male(M)12.0%],war exposure 19.3%(F 9.3%,M 36.7%),and post-traumatic stress disorder(PTSD)5.6%(F 6.4%,M 4.3%).Significant associations with IBS in the civilian population were observed(adjusted by gender,age,socioeconomic status,education):physical and psychological abuse[adjusted odds ratio(aOR):2.25;95%confidence interval:1.1-4.5],witnessed execution(aOR:2.4;1.1-5.2),family member death(aOR:2.2;1.2-4.2),and multiple exposures(aOR:2.7;1.4-5.1).PTSD was independently associated with IBS(aOR:2.6;1.2-5.7).CONCLUSION An enduring association was observed in the Nicaragua civilian population between specific civil war-related events and subsequent IBS.Civilian populations in regions with extended armed conflict may warrant provider education and targeted interventions for patients. | Edgar M Peña-Galo Daniel Wurzelmann Javier Alcedo Rodolfo Peña Loreto Cortes Douglas Morgan | 2023 | World Journal of Gastroenterology2023,29,45: | 0 |
